Guernsey Arts Open 2023 – Paisley Fractal in Silver
We’re delighted to announce that we’ve been accepted for the Guernsey Arts Open Exhibition at the George Crossan Gallery which starts in October.
We’ve painted a 6ft long canvas and drawn intricate paisley and lace inspired spiral motifs. Once again a labour of love. Creating a pattern that looks like it could occur in nature with the elements of crafted human elements like lace. Embracing the ever intertwined relationships between our perception of design and nature.
Combining our some of our favourite things – spirals , patterns , super tiny details and metallic colours.

Small Pictures Exhibition – July to August 2016
The Small Pictures Exhibition, hosted by the Guernsey Art Network as part of the Skipton Art Festival 2016 was held at the Folk and Costume Museum, Saumarez Park. Housed in one of the old stables which lent a quaint atmosphere to this eclectic exhibition. Contributing artists were invited to enter pictures not exceeding 12 inches square with an open theme.
This peices is a part of our butterflies around a hole collection – this addtion is made from Bombay Sapphire packaging from our collection of found materials that we have built up over the years.

Wall of Art – August 2016
Hosted by Sula Gallery, the 2016 Wall of Art was organised by the Guernsey Art Network as part of the Skipton Art Festival 2016. Exhibiting artists were encouraged to enter one piece each to this non-curated exhibition, showing the true breadth of Guernsey’s artistic talent.
